Transaction 038c656d10afc2e887166a79d56d25f91b8284d399c6e25be86e8902e5ae3b26
1 Input
1 Output
-
038c656d10afc2e887166a79d56d25f91b8284d399c6e25be86e8902e5ae3b26:0
- value
- 79528
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ba610f0da1a9238838b8ed6fd75ae89223b63d55
- address
- bc1qhfss7rdp4y3csw9ca4hawkhgjg3mv024ufdx45